Arriva Sports Headphones ($30)
You may not have heard of Arriva, as it is only a small company in Colorado that is trying to make a name for itself. Its headphones are 100% geared toward the active individual. Because it are such a small company, its headphones are only available at its website or at Amazon.

I chose these headphones because of their great design. They will not fall out of your ears because of a design which is unlike any other in today's market. Arriva has designed these headphones with a soft rubber ear-bud piece which fits inside of your ear. There are three different sizes of rubber tip which come with the purchase of these headphones.
What is unique about these headphones is the headphone cord which wraps around the back of your head and keeps the ear-buds securely in your ear. On Arriva's website there is a video of a guy jumping on a trampoline with the headphones on and doing various twists and turns, and the headphones stay securely in his ears during all of this. On top of that, the headphones are barely visible when you wear them.
The sound quality of these headphones is not stellar. They produce average quality sound with not very good bass response. The reason I chose these headphones, though, was because of the great design which keeps the ear bud in your ear no matter what kind of workout you are performing. These headphones are available on Arriva's website for $30, and you can purchase refurbished ones for only $15. If Arriva addresses their less than perfect sound quality in future models, it will definitely have something great on its hands.
